System for operating especially for remote controlling and telemonitoring, unmanned radio transmitters
First Claim
1. A system for remotely controlling and monitoring a radio broadcast transmitter of a radio-transmitting station according to the DIN IEC 864 standard, said system comprising a remote-control device through which operating functions of the broadcast transmitter of the radio-transmitting station according to the DIN IEC 864 standard are continuously monitored and remote-controlled from a center located remote from the broadcast transmitter, the radio broadcast transmitter of the radio-transmitting station according to the DIN IEC 864 standard broadcasts a radio signal as a primary mode of communication, the center including an Internet browser and being connected to the broadcast transmitter through a public or private network different than the primary mode of communication by:
- (a) a first connection comprising the Internet browser of the center communicating through the network to an Internet server connected to the remote control device of the broadcast transmitter, such that the operating functions of the broadcast transmitter are interrogated and remote controlled according to HTTP protocol; and
(b) a second checkback connection comprising;
one of (i) an SNMP manager in the center communicating through the network to an SNMP agent connected to the remote-control device of the broadcast transmitter, and (ii) an Internet server in the center communicating through the network by HTTP to an Internet client assigned to the remote-control device of the broadcast transmitter, wherein the operating functions of the broadcast transmitter are transmitted automatically from the broadcast transmitter to the center via the second checkback connection without prompting from the center, the operating functions of the broadcast transmitter are transmitted via the second checkback connection to the center only in the event of interfering deviations in the operating functions, and the Internet server is embedded with the remote-control device of the broadcast transmitter to form a unit.

Abstract
The invention relates to remote controlling and telemonitoring an unmanned radio transmitter (1), which can be controlled from a center if required. The center is connected to the remote-controlled transmitters via a public or private network and the operational functions of the transmitter are, if required, remote-controlled or interrogated by the center, according to the HTTP protocol, via a connection to a server/browser network linked to the remote-control device; simultaneously, the operational functions are automatically transmitted, without a prompt, from the transmitter to the centre (2) via a checkback network connection according to the SNMP- or HTTP-principle.
